Key Responsibilities

  • Manage projects, ensuring budgets and deadlines are achieved.
  • Prepare, review and approve Transport Assessments, Transport Statements, Travel Plans and Technical Notes.
  • Produce and review planning drawings, including visibility splays, vehicle tracking and access designs.
  • Use transport modelling software to calculate trip generation and distribution.
  • Prepare appeal documentation, including Statements of Case and Statements of Common Ground.
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with clients, project teams and local authorities.
  • Attend client meetings, public consultations and highway authority meetings.
  • Assist with fee proposals and tender submissions.
  • Mentor and support junior members of the transport planning team.
